Free Legal Advice, authored by MR GAVIN WARD, guides users to free legal advice providers based on user's queries. The GPT is designed to cater to legal needs and aid in accessing pro bono legal services across different countries such as the UK, Australia, Canada, and Ireland. The tool leverages DALL·E and browser resources to deliver optimal guidance and support to its users. It aims to fill the gap for those seeking legal assistance by providing personalized and relevant information adapted to the users' specific queries. The tool offers prompt starters that prompt users to seek guidance on finding free legal advice in various locations. With an insightful welcome message, it ensures a user-friendly experience.
